Power

You supply power to the board from the mains supply using the on‑board connector and the connector
cable that Arm supplies with the board.
Arm supplies an external power supply unit which converts mains power to 12V DC which connects to
the 12V connector on the board. The unit accepts mains power in the range 110V AC to 240V AC.
If you supply your own external mains adaptor, it must be a Low‑Power Source. Some such are marked
LPS on their rating label. Otherwise it might be necessary to consult you adaptor supplier to ensure that it
meets this criterion.
Alternatively, you can connect an external 12V DC supply, +/- 10%, directly to the 12V connector.
Any external 12V DC +/- 10% power supply that is used must be a limited power source.
On‑board regulators supply power to the board power domains and to the FPGA power domains.
The PWR LED illuminates when the MCC is powered up and active.
